linux命令怎么设置时区

不及物动词 其他 89

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要设置Linux系统的时区,可以按照以下步骤进行操作:

    1. 使用root用户或具有sudo权限的用户登录到Linux系统上。

    2. 打开终端窗口,执行以下命令来打开时区设置文件:

    “`shell
    sudo vi /etc/timezone
    “`

    3. 在打开的文件中,使用vi编辑器修改时区信息。可以使用上下键来移动光标,定位到正确的时区。

    4. 将时区信息修改为需要设置的时区。例如,设置为北京时间的时区,可以将时区信息修改为”Asia/Shanghai”。

    5. 保存修改并退出vi编辑器,按下 Esc 键后键入 “:wq”,然后按下 Enter 键。

    6. 执行以下命令来应用新的时区设置:

    “`shell
    sudo dpkg-reconfigure -f noninteractive tzdata
    “`

    7. 系统会提示当前时区设置已更改,可以按下 Enter 键继续。

    8. 接下来会出现一个菜单界面,可以使用上下键来选择正确的时区。

    9. 选中正确的时区后,按下空格键选中,然后按下 Tab 键来选中”OK”,最后按下 Enter 键。

    10. 系统会自动重新配置时区设置,并将系统时间刷新为新的时区。

    11. 验证时区设置是否成功,可以执行以下命令来查看当前系统时区:

    “`shell
    date
    “`

    12. 系统会显示当前日期和时间,确保时区显示的是你所设置的时区。

    通过以上步骤,你可以成功设置Linux系统的时区。请注意,必须以root用户身份或具有sudo权限的用户执行以上命令才能有效设置时区。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用如下命令来设置时区:

    1. 查看当前的时区设置
    `timedatectl show –property=Timezone`

    2. 列出所有可用的时区
    `timedatectl list-timezones`

    3. 设置时区
    `sudo timedatectl set-timezone <时区名称>`

    例如,如果要设置时区为”Asia/Shanghai”,则可以使用以下命令:
    `sudo timedatectl set-timezone Asia/Shanghai`

    4. 通过配置文件设置时区
    可以通过修改`/etc/localtime`文件来设置时区。可以通过以下命令完成操作:
    `sudo 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ime`

    先删除现有的`/etc/localtime`文件:
    `sudo rm /etc/localtime`
    然后创建一个符号链接指向目标时区文件:
    `sudo ln -s /usr/share/zoneinfo/Asia/Shanghai /etc/localtime`

    5. 验证时区设置
    可以通过输入`date`命令来验证是否成功设置了时区。输出的时间应该与所选择的时区一致。

    请注意,上述命令中的时区名称可能因不同的Linux发行版而有所差异。确保使用正确的时区名称以保证准确的设置。另外,有些命令可能需要以管理员身份运行,所以可能需要使用`sudo`命令来获取足够的权限。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    设置Linux系统的时区可以通过以下方法实现:

    方法一:使用tzselect命令

    1. 打开终端,输入tzselect命令,并按下Enter键。
    2. 系统会显示一系列地区列表,请根据地区选择相应的数字,例如选择”8″表示选择亚洲地区。
    3. 然后,系统会显示一个子地区列表,请根据相应的数字选择子地区,例如选择”40″表示选择中国。
    4. 最后,系统会显示所选择的时区信息,例如Asia/Shanghai,表示亚洲/上海时区。将该时区信息复制。
    5. 打开/etc/profile文件,输入sudo vi /etc/profile命令并按下Enter键进入编辑模式。
    6. 在文件末尾添加以下内容:

    “`
    TZ=’Asia/Shanghai’; export TZ
    “`

    将Asia/Shanghai替换为你所选择的时区信息。

    7. 保存文件并退出编辑模式。
    8. 输入source /etc/profile命令以使配置生效。

    方法二:使用dpkg-reconfigure命令

    1. 打开终端,输入sudo dpkg-reconfigure tzdata命令并按下Enter键。
    2. 系统会显示一个时区配置界面,请用上下箭头键选择相应的时区。
    3. 使用空格键勾选当前地区所在城市,然后按下Tab键并按下Enter键确认选择。

    方法三:直接修改/etc/localtime文件

    1. 打开终端,输入sudo c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ime命令并按下Enter键。
    将Asia/Shanghai替换为你所选择的时区信息。
    2. 输入sudo vi /etc/timezone命令并按下Enter键,进入编辑模式。
    3. 将文件中的内容替换为你所选择的时区信息,例如Asia/Shanghai。
    4. 保存文件并退出编辑模式。

    方法四:使用timedatectl命令

    1. 打开终端,输入sudo timedatectl set-timezone Asia/Shanghai命令并按下Enter键。
    将Asia/Shanghai替换为你所选择的时区信息。

    以上四种方法都可以成功设置Linux系统的时区,可以根据自己的喜好和操作习惯选择适合自己的方法来设置时区。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部